Background technique
Interventional cardiac procedures are a kind of new diagnostic and treatment cardiovascular disease technology, refer to the thigh root or hand in patientThe instrument of various treatments is sent by the positions such as heart or blood vessel by core tube technology on wrist, passes through specific cardiac catheterThe diagnosis and treatment method that operating technology is made a definite diagnosis heart disease and treated, it is heart disease diagnosis and treatment method relatively advanced at present, intoExhibition is also very fast, it is a kind of invasive diagnosis and treatment method between medical treatment and surgical operation therapy;Including coronal dynamicArteries and veins radiography, PTCA+ stenting, percutaneous balloon mitral commissurotomy, radio-frequency ablation procedure, pacemaker implantation, congenital heart disease are situated betweenEnter treatment, the intracavitary thrombolysis art of coronary artery.During interventional cardiac procedures, valvular notch is sutured,In sewing process, suture needs to knot, in order to guarantee heart valve notch stabilization and securely, needed during knotting bySuture tightens.To generally knot in vitro accomplish fluently then with suture knot pusher push this knot pricked into.
Solid, reliable knot is one of key factor of successful surgery.Clinically knotting method used has gimmick to beatIt ties and two kinds of instrumental tie.The former is difficult to complete in the case where surgical finger cannot be got at, therefore is not suitable for heartIntervention operation knots;Instrumental tie is suitable for deep operation, common to have knot method and sleeve joint method two ways, is required to looking at straightIn the case of complete.Knot method is to pinch an arm of suture on the other hand by doctor, the other hand knot pusher is by helping after gimmick knottingAnother arm of the knot suture of hand grip pushes down, and is then log out knot pusher, then push away second knot with identical gimmick.This sideAlthough method can complete the generation of deep knot, conventional suture knot pusher structure is relatively simple, and often careless manipulation willIt causes that slip goes offline or knot is not in place, leads to the failure of entire knot, so as to cause serious consequence.

Specific embodiment
As shown in Figure 1, the present invention includes knot pusher handle 1 and the knot pusher bar that is fixedly connected with the knot pusher handle 13, the end of the knot pusher bar 3 is provided with knot head, and the knot head includes the hard silicone tube that one end is connect with knot pusher bar 34 and the soft silica gel plug 5 that connect with the other end of the hard silicone tube 4, the hard silicone tube 4 and knot pusher bar 3 are in hollowStructure, the wire casing 7 for placing suture is offered on the side wall of the hard silicone tube 4, and the wire casing 7 is dovetail groove, the ladderThe two sidewalls of shape slot are tilted to center, are provided in the knot pusher bar 3 and are pushed away line inner core 6, the diameter for pushing away line inner core 6 with push awayThe internal diameter of knot device bar 3 matches, and the length for pushing away line inner core 6 is greater than the length of knot pusher bar 3, on the knot pusher handle 1It is provided with and pushes away torsion 2 along what 3 axial direction of knot pusher bar moved for pushing away line inner core 6, the line inner core 6 that pushes away is towards hardOne end of silicone tube 4 offers cross recess.
In actual use, since the suture knot pusher is used in interventional cardiac procedures, the thigh root from patient is neededEither enter the positions such as heart or blood vessel in wrist, longer into length, traditional knot pusher bar is made of all-metal, is heldEasily stimulation or impair cardiac, therefore the application connects hard silicone tube 4 and soft silica gel plug 5, hard silicone tube 4 on knot pusher bar 4It is made with soft silica gel plug 5 by nontoxic silica gel material, silica gel material is a kind of high activity adsorbent material, is belonged to non-Amorphous material, silica gel main component are silica, and chemical property is stablized, do not burn, and in intervention procedure, can avoid heart damageWound, will not stimulate or impair cardiac, using effect are good.
In actual use, the wire casing 7 for placing suture is offered on the side wall of hard silicone tube 4, wire casing 7 is dovetail groove,The two sidewalls of the dovetail groove are tilted to center, so that the opening of wire casing 7 is small, it is existing to reduce slippage of the suture in progradationAs.
In actual use, setting pushes away line inner core 6 inside knot pusher bar 3, pushes away the diameter and knot pusher bar 3 of line inner core 6Internal diameter matches, and the length for pushing away line inner core 6 is greater than the length of knot pusher bar 3, and pushing away on knot pusher handle 1 is arranged in by pushing2 are turned round, is moved so that pushing away line inner core 6 along 3 axial direction of knot pusher bar, line inner core 6 is pushed away and plays the role of the hard silicone tube 4 of support, makeObtaining hard silicone tube 4 can intervene along predetermined direction.The side wall for pushing away line inner core 6 and wire casing 7 simultaneously, which matches, can play clamping sutureEffect, further avoids slip phenomenon of the suture in progradation.When suture, which has, slips dangerous, push away on line inner core 6Cross recess can play the role of clamping suture, meanwhile, the side wall of the wire casing 7 of trapezoidal slot can also play what limitation suture slippedEffect.
In the present embodiment, the length of the hard silicone tube 4 is 3~8cm.Therefore hard silicone tube 4 has 3~8cm radiusScope of activities operates convenient for performer.
In the present embodiment, the wire casing 7 is fillet wire casing.Fillet wire casing can avoid rubbing suture.
In the present embodiment, the soft silica gel plug 5 is cup head plug.
In the present embodiment, the length of the knot pusher bar 3 is 50~70cm.The length of 50~70cm can meet Cardiac interventionalThe length of operation needs.
